Oklahoma is Cattle Country. Everywhere you go in our state, you will see cattle grazing in fields at the side of the road. Cattle graze on Oklahoma grasslands in almost every one of our 77 counties.
The beef industry generates more income than any other agricultural enterprise in our state. In 2015, Oklahoma's beef cattle inventory was 1.9 million. That same year, Oklahoma ranked number two in the nation in the production of beef cattle, number five in the production of cattle and calves, number 9 for cattle on feed and number three for our calf crop.
Beef is an important part of a healthy diet for humans. About 50 separate nutrients are essential to our good health. No single food contains all of these nutrients. For this reason, dietitians and health providers recommend consuming a variety of foods daily from several different food categories. One of the nutrients you need, Vitamin B12, can be found only in animal foods, such as beef. Beef also provides significant amounts of other important nutrients protein, riboflavin, niacin, iron and zinc.
